Pool Hall Hangouts in Pueblo, Colorado
Discover the charm of spending time at a pool hall in Pueblo, Colorado, where the focus is on the game and not on alcohol.
A Nostalgic Pastime
During my younger years, I spent countless hours at pool halls in Pueblo, Colorado. While the town has numerous bars and billiard rooms, only a few truly epitomized the essence of a pool hall. These were places where the emphasis was solely on the game, without the distraction of alcohol, featuring only a selection of video games alongside the pool tables.
The Corner Cigar Store
Today, only one of these iconic establishments remains: the Corner Cigar Store. This venue is home to six 9-foot antique Brunswick tables. It became our regular gathering spot, where we played everything from one-pocket to ring 9-ball, a format involving three or more players, often with a little wager to spice things up.
I recall some gambling matches that extended late into the night and sometimes into the next day. I loved arriving early to practice before the competition began. There’s nothing quite like the thrill of wagering on a game of pocket billiards.
Life's Changes
Nowadays, with a busy schedule and family commitments, I don’t get to enjoy pool halls as often. My opportunities to play are mostly limited to league nights held in bars. However, I hope that one day, perhaps in retirement, I can rekindle my passion for spending days at the pool hall. For now, those fond memories sustain me.
